Transaction f758678b106c3991dbff491bdfafe2175ddb3ac89aafd3df11d743c7b103e022
1 Input
2 Outputs
- f758678b106c3991dbff491bdfafe2175ddb3ac89aafd3df11d743c7b103e022:0
- f758678b106c3991dbff491bdfafe2175ddb3ac89aafd3df11d743c7b103e022:1
value 35000000
address 1LSnJ3X8S3rM56kzYAbnkqAnAhqKmJF2HX
value 104119258
address 1QBhbjpxSegqApNwYjfJ9seU2cvTU15x5p